Starman (of 1951)

Custom Minimate figure

During 1951 Ted Knight, the Golden Age Starman, was recovering from his nervous breakdown and was unable to defend Opal City. Suddenly, a new masked Starman stepped in to defend the city. This Starman flew around the city in a star-shaped craft and fought crime with power blasts and super-strength. At the end of 1951, the new Starman disappeared as mysteriously as he appeared.

The Recipe

The Starman of 1951 is made from a repainted Minimate. His mask is made from a modified Daredevil mask with a Magic Sculpt fin. His cape and wrist details are also made from Magic Sculpt. The chest details are made from a combination of printouts and water-transfer decals.
